1976年イングランド生まれ。英国で生物医学と美術を学んだ後に、2015年に京都市立芸術大学にて博士号を取得。博士論文「空想主義的客観論:現代美術におけるダイアグラム的思考」は梅原猛賞を受賞し、また芸術と科学を横断する学術論文誌「レオナルド・ジャーナル」(MIT出版)のトップリストに選出された。京都を拠点に世界各地で作品を発表している。
Michael Whittle was born in England in 1976. After studying biomedicine and then art in the U.K., acquired a doctorate from Kyoto City University of Arts in 2015. His PhD thesis “Romantic Objectivism: diagrammatic thought in contemporary art” won the Takeshi Umehara prize and was selected by MIT Press' Leonardo for it's top 10 list of research in art and science. Whittle lives and works in Kyoto and exhibits and lectures internationally.
